java - 无法创建新 session 。 appium 代码错误

标签 java selenium-webdriver appium

无法创建新 session 。 (原始错误:请求了一个新 session ,但一个正在进行中)如果我第二次运行我的代码,则会显示此错误。第一次工作正常

为selenium编写代码

public static void main(String[] args) throws MalformedURLException{

        DesiredCapabilities capabilities = new DesiredCapabilities();
        capabilities.setCapability("appium-version", "1.0");
        capabilities.setCapability("platformName", "Android");
        capabilities.setCapability("platformVersion", "4.4");
        capabilities.setCapability("deviceName", "AndroidTest");
        System.out.println("iii");
        capabilities.setCapability("app", "/Users/gurpreet/Desktop/nimbuzz-3.2.0-rc4-debug.apk");
        System.out.println("iii");
        WebDriver driver = new RemoteWebDriver(new URL("http://0.0.0.0:4723/wd/hub"), capabilities);

        driver.findElement(By.id("com.nimbuzz:id/btnSignInSplash")).click();
}
}

谁能提出解决方案/

最佳答案

试试下面的

在appium工具->常规设置->选择覆盖现有 session

关于java - 无法创建新 session 。 appium 代码错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25863034/

相关文章:

firefox - 带有 Java 代码的 WebDriver 不打开 Firefox,在 Windows XP 中什么也不做

javascript - 如何仅从 selenium 中的网页加载 html

java - Google Webmaster Tools API 能否用于自动修复 URL Page Not Found 错误?

java - 面临 Spring AOP 中 Before 建议的问题

java - 这里如何避免使用全局变量?

java - 如何使用 selenium webdriver 从查找字段中选择值

java - 我想滑动直到 View 中出现向下的元素(iOS)

java - 有没有人尝试过为 appium 移动应用程序自动化创建本地设备实验室

java - 如何在自动化 android webView 的情况下解决 "Cannot call non W3C standard command while in W3C mode"

java - Spring Boot,Spring Security 与数据库链接